Dummy for Wheelchair Vehicle Testing

The Dummy for Wheelchair Vehicle Testing is designed to simulate the physical characteristics and mass distribution of a human occupant during wheelchair transport. It is used to evaluate the performance of wheelchair restraint systems and vehicle safety under dynamic conditions. Manufactured in accordance with ISO 7176-11:2012 and GB/T 12996-2024 standards, it ensures consistent, repeatable, and reliable test results for safety verification and compliance assessment.
Compliance Standards:
The test dummy meets the requirements of:
European Standard: ISO 7176-11:2012
New Chinese Standard: GB/T 12996-2024
Total Mass of the Dummy: 100 kg
Articulation Features:
The lower legs of the dummy can move up, down, left, and right.
The footplate joints are movable.

Table 2: Dimensions of Thigh Loading Plate
Manikin Weight Range Kg | L1 mm | L2 mm | L3 mm | L4 mm |
25≤mdummy<50 | 200 | 300 | 80 | 150 |
50≤mdummy<75 | 260 | 350 | 100 | 175 |
75≤mdummy<100 | 320 | 380 | 105 | 160 |
100≤mdummy<125 | 380 | 420 | 110 | 135 |
125≤mdummy<150 | 430 | 440 | 115 | 110 |
150≤mdummy<175 | 480 | 440 | 120 | 100 |
175≤mdummy<200 | 530 | 440 | 120 | 100 |
200≤mdummy<250 | 570 | 440 | 120 | 100 |
250≤mdummy<300 | 630 | 440 | 120 | 100 |
mdummy≥300 | 680 | 440 | 120 | 100 |
Tolerances for all linear dimensions: ±15 mm. Note: Dimensions are based on typical wheelchair seat sizes used for occupants within the specified weight ranges. | ||||

Table 3: Dimensions of Torso and Foot Loading Plates
Manikin Weight Range Kg | Torso Loading Plate | Foot Loading Plate | ||
L1 mm | L2 mm | L3 mm | L4 mm | |
25≤mdummy<50 | 180 | 380 | 80 | 200 |
50≤mdummy<75 | 230 | 440 | 100 | 300 |
75≤mdummy<100 | 290 | 490 | 100 | 300 |
100≤mdummy<125 | 350 | 540 | 100 | 300 |
125≤mdummy<150 | 400 | 540 | 100 | 300 |
150≤mdummy<175 | 450 | 540 | 100 | 300 |
175≤mdummy<200 | 500 | 540 | 100 | 300 |
200≤mdummy<250 | 540 | 540 | 100 | 300 |
250≤mdummy<300 | 600 | 540 | 100 | 300 |
mdummy≥300 | 650 | 540 | 100 | 300 |
Tolerances for all linear dimensions: ±15 mm. Note: Dimensions are based on typical wheelchair seat sizes used for occupants within the specified weight ranges. | ||||
